About this House

Unique opportunity for 4 bed/2.5 bath, 2,509 SqFt single story 1972 masonry stucco Mid-Century Modern Ranch on premium .43 acre CR2 corner lot with no HOA, space for RV/camper parking, daily Catalina mountain views located on whisper quiet street in desirable Sabino Vista neighborhood in North Tucson. Searching for character and charm? Yearning for nostalgia?? This vintage home is the next best thing to owning a time machine! Rare find priced below the $590K RVM property value report and below the Zillow ''Zestimate''. Owned by the same family since 1976 and offered for sale for the first time, this home showcases exceptional pride of ownership.
Featuring N/S orientation, architectural shingle roof, round driveway, 571 SqFt covered multiple car carport, expansive concrete driveway, on & off street parking, massive front mature joshua tree, masonry stucco walled side courtyard w/large mesquite shade tree, metal security doors and set of double wood doors. Step inside the foyer featuring original honey saltillo octagon flooring, textured natural seagrass wallpaper, step down into sunken living room with amazing natural light and wood burning fireplace, formal dining room, original light fixtures and hardware, original wood internal doors, wood siding, wired for alarm, copper plumbing, Trane gas HVAC (new 2023), digital thermostat, gas water heater (new 2023), intercom speaker system, laundry room with half/bath washer and dryer included. Wonderfully preserved vintage kitchen that captures the charm of a bygone era with yellow flowered-powered flooring, original avocado green 1973 Hotpoint dual oven, ample countertop space, original wood cabinets, peninsula counter with bar seating opens to spacious family room with stacked rock wood burning w/gas option fireplace, dining area with cool atomic telescoping light. Spacious bedrooms, guest bathroom w/executive height dual sink counter, fabric wallpaper, shower and tub. Large primary suite featuring slider to private backyard, ensuite full bathroom with dual sink counter, walk-in shower and exhaust fan.
Enjoy tranquil Tucson sunsets under extended covered 360 SqFt backyard patio, low maintenance backyard with omnipresent Catalina mountain views, gate access, storage shed with power, all surrounded by block privacy walls. The expansive lot provides ample space for a future swimming pool, outdoor entertaining areas, guest quarters, or simply enjoying the beauty of the Sonoran Desert.
Located walking distance to highly ranked Fruchthendler Elementary School, Tanque Verde Wash, the Chuck Huckelberry Loop ("The Loop") is a 131-mile, paved, shared-use path encircling the city and connecting with neighboring communities. It's designed for walking, biking, skating, and even horseback riding, offering a safe, car-free environment for recreation and commuting. Minutes away from acclaimed Sabino Canyon Park, Udall Park, shopping, groceries, pharmacy, banking and restaurants.
